Spain has launched an ambitious €700 million (around $796 million) program to increase its energy storage capacity. This plan will add 2.5 to 3.5 gigawatts (GW) of storage. It includes pumped hydro, thermal energy storage, and battery systems. The goal is to improve how Spain uses renewable energy

The frequency of low prices (<20 €/MWh) peaks at the end of this decade and then decreases throughout the horizon due to the integration of storage sources, as they add demand during low-price hours. The frequency of very high prices (>100 €/MWh) is reduced dramatically between and ;

The different types of energy storage solutions in Spain are batteries, Pumped-storage Hydroelectricity (PSH), Thermal Energy Storage (TES), and Flywheel Energy Storage (FES),
